Thanks, John, that explains the difference all right. In DC, the norm is
that a historic district is first designated local (with review), then national
(mere formality).
Also, I read with caution the Baltimore change of CHAP into the planning
office. DC did the same a few years ago with their equivalent (Hist Pres
Division and HP Review Board), without first thinking through the enforcement
issue; now that they are part of planning, they have no enforcement of violations
capability like they did when they were formerly with DCRA. I suspect the
same will happen with CHAP.
